Ticket: DEPLOYBOT-412 — Expired credentials for Hushpipe deploy-status bot

The Hushpipe chat bot stopped posting deploy status updates on Monday because its credential for the internal Shipgate status API expired. No alerts fired since the bot fails silently on 401 responses; a follow-up ticket covers adding an expiry alarm. A replacement credential has been issued with the same read-only scope and a 90-day lifetime. For reviewer verification, the reissued Shipgate key is recorded below.

service key, tadup-yagep: kto23_Eoog5Djh7wQNnUcbvpYZZfG

## Runbook: Slow Autocomplete Index

The Quillfind autocomplete index degrades when the segment count exceeds the merge threshold. Symptoms: p95 latency over 400ms, rising rejected queries. Check merge backlog first. If merges are stuck, force a manual merge during low traffic — never during the morning peak. Note for security review: the index node accepts queries only from the gateway subnet; direct access is blocked, and all merge operations are logged. No credentials are stored on the index nodes themselves. Current index settings follow.

deployment values, yadup-kadug:
[sorys]
port = 5672
team = noveth
host = sorys.orvexcorp.example
region = south-4
access_code = ac_deddc1
timeout_ms = 1500

Handover: TimeGrid solver. Marek, it's yours now. Solver converges on Brockfield Academy datasets but stalls on split-campus inputs; suspect the room-adjacency constraint weights. Nightly batch runs at 02:00, retries twice. Don't touch the pruning heuristic until the Larkspur rewrite lands. Staging mirrors prod except for thread counts. Current settings that the solver boots with are listed below.

deployment values, yagaf-tawif:
[zorael]
team = pelix
access_code = ac_be383e
host = zorael.tolvaqio.internal
port = 8080
owner = druath.ulador
peer = fendor.tolvaqcorp.corp